The challenges we humans face.

Some of these films cover sensitive topics with references or scenes that some my find difficult, please contact the organiser for more detail.

GOLDEN YEARS : Comedy. Drama: 15min: Tim Ritter: USA 

An aging couple break into rich people’s homes and throw themselves parties to spice up their retirement. But with potential problems looming with both family and the police, how much longer can the party last?

I CAN DO THIS: Drama: 14min: Adrien Orville: Belgium

Didier tries to recreate the bond with his son Clément, who is raising a 5-year-old boy on his own. But as he struggles to fit into the young father’s routine, Didier wants to prove to Clément that he is capable of looking after a child.

MYANMAR: Drama: 17min : Hananeh Daliri: Iran

Mohammad, the youngest son of the family, falls into a coma. While his mother is away on a pilgrimage and unaware of the situation, the family faces a tense moral crisis that threatens to tear them apart.

NEVER: Drama: 17min: Barak Stern: Israel

On the last night of their vacation, Shachar and Guy visit Nitzan and Ella’s room, whom they just met. Guy urges Shachar to lose his virginity, forcing Shachar to choose between proving his manhood and adhering to his moral code.

OBLIVIO: Drama: 12min: Luigi Tomasino: Italy

In the silence of a secluded grove, a young man wanders through the labyrinth of his own mind, seeking meaning in what he uncovers.

THE AGENT: Comedy: 17min : Michal Redlus, Avia Brosh Yerushalmi: Israel

A struggling actress locks herself in with her indifferent agent, demanding answers. A fleeting audition offer sparks their hopes, but when it vanishes, they remain trapped in mediocrity.

TIME TO SMILE: Documentary: 12min: Jonas Almeida Braga Amarante: Portugal

By observing the tourists who are part of the landscape of Belém, in Lisbon, reflections on colonialism, emigration, identity, and tourism are constructed.
